FuxiTranyu: A Multilingual Large Language Model Trained with Balanced Data (2024.emnlp-industry)

Haoran Sun, Renren Jin, Shaoyang Xu, Leiyu Pan, null Supryadi, Menglong Cui, Jiangcun Du, Yikun Lei, Lei Yang, Ling Shi, Juesi Xiao, Shaolin Zhu, Deyi Xiong
| Challenge: | Large language models exhibit significant performance discrepancies between high- and low-resource languages. |
| Approach: | They present an open-source multilingual LLM with 8 billion parameters and a multilingual instruction dataset. |
| Outcome: | The proposed model achieves consistent multilingual representations across languages. |

Multilingual Machine Translation with Open Large Language Models at Practical Scale: An Empirical Study (2025.naacl-long)

| Challenge: | Large language models (LLMs) have shown continuously improving multilingual capabilities. |
| Approach: | They evaluate the ability of open LLMs to handle multilingual machine translation tasks using a parallel-first monolingual-second data mixing strategy. |
| Outcome: | The proposed model outperforms state-of-the-art models and achieves competitive performance with Google Translate and GPT-4-turbo. |
